Combating Fraud and Enhancing Security in Civic Systems

The shift toward modernized digital portals comes after a surge in sophisticated phone and email scams targeting summoned individuals. Fraudsters have historically mimicked local court communications, demanding immediate payment for "missed jury duty" to exploit public confusion.

By centralizing operations through the official jury duty portal, court administrators aim to eliminate these vulnerabilities entirely. Registered users can now instantly verify the legitimacy of any communication by logging into their encrypted, state-verified secure dashboard.

Furthermore, judicial systems are phasing out legacy paper-only summons in favor of hybrid QR-code mailers. These secure mailers direct citizens straight to their local portal, reducing mail-handling errors and protecting private identity details.

How to Access Your Juror Dashboard and Verify Summons Status

Accessing your local jury duty portal requires specific credentials found on your physical mailer. To ensure a seamless login and avoid potential legal penalties, follow these key verification steps:



  • Locate Your Badge Number: Find the unique juror ID and PIN printed on your paper summons.
  • Verify the Web Domain: Always ensure the web address ends in .gov or your state's verified court URL before entering credentials.
  • Complete the Questionnaire: Submit required medical, age, or financial exemption requests directly through the portal's secure document uploader.

Courts are warning the public that official administrators will never ask for gift cards, cryptocurrency, or wire transfers to resolve an active summons. All legitimate communications, scheduling adjustments, and excused statuses are processed strictly within the portal dashboard.

Next-Gen Upgrades Scheduled for the 2026-2027 Judicial Term

Looking ahead, state courts plan to integrate advanced scheduling algorithms into the jury duty portal to minimize unnecessary waiting times in courthouse assembly rooms. Trials scheduled for late 2026 and early 2027 will utilize "on-call" digital tracking, alerting potential jurors via text only when their specific panel is active.

Additionally, pilot programs for virtual orientation videos are being embedded directly into the login pipeline. This allows jurors to complete their mandatory training from home before ever arriving at the courthouse. This modernization effort is expected to save millions in municipal administrative costs while respecting citizens' valuable time.
